Contents Life in the trenches -- Starting out -- Big dog -- Incredible wealth -- Buddyball -- Eagle in the storm -- Wins-and deep losses -- "Reggie, this is god ..." -- Rambos of Lambeau -- Miracles in the trenches -- Fighting fire -- How to be a hero.
Abstract Reggie White tells of his eleven years in the NFL, the Green Bay Packers' amazing turnaround, the close race for Super Bowl XXX, the injuries that nearly ended his career, and his ambitions for the next Super Bowl. Also discusses his influence as an ordained minister.
